The government has announced full details on the funeral for the victims of the August 6 helicopter crash in Adansi Akrufuom, which claimed eight lives.
The ceremony, slated for Friday, August 15, 2025, will be a full military service conducted by the Ghana Armed Forces (GAF).
Speaking at a press conference on Thursday, August 14, Deputy Chief of Staff, Stan Dogbey, noted that the funeral will take place in three parts; Bible and Qur'an recitals, the main service, and the burial at the Black Star Square.
The pre-burial programme will begin at 7:00am and end at 9:00 am.
